Due to closure of Attari border, long queues of vehicles formed


After India closed the Attari border, citizens coming to Pakistan were stranded at the border.
Due to the closure of the Attari border, long queues of vehicles formed, and those returning to Pakistan are facing problems.
Indian authorities also stopped a woman holding an Indian passport from going to Pakistan.
The woman said that the immigration authorities stopped her because she had an Indian passport, she got married in Pakistan, and she wants to return home.
Meanwhile, an Indian woman in Karachi, who had come to Pakistan to meet her brother after 40 years, is now returning home because of the situation. The woman said that she felt very good to be here, but now that she has to leave quickly, she is crying.
